Q. What computer do I need for Photoshop?

Aim for a quad-core, 3 GHz CPU, 8 GB of RAM, a small SSD, and maybe a GPU for a good computer that can handle most Photoshop needs. If you’re a heavy user, with large image files and extensive editing, consider a 3.5-4 GHz CPU, 16-32 GB RAM, and maybe even ditch the hard drives for a full SSD kit.

Q. Can I run Adobe Photoshop on 2GB RAM?

Photoshop can use as much as 2GB of RAM when running on a 32-bit system. However, if you have 2GB of RAM installed, you won’t want Photoshop to use all of it. Otherwise, you won’t have any RAM left for the system, causing it to use the virtual memory on disk, which is much slower.

Q. Can I get an old version of Photoshop for free?

The key to this whole deal is that Adobe allows a free Photoshop download only for an old version of the app. Namely Photoshop CS2, which was released in May 2005. CS2 was one of the first versions of the Photoshop, if not the very first, with Internet activation.

Q. Is there a one time purchase for Photoshop?

If you want to be able to perform random edits to photos in the future without paying for a subscription or re-subscribing every time you want to edit photos, you’ll need to buy a standalone version of Photoshop. With Photoshop Elements, you pay once and own it forever.
